EKYC for Ration Card : Why eKYC is Now Mandatory for Ration Cards

The introduction of electronic Know Your Customer (eKYC) authentication for ration cardholders is a government measure to streamline the public distribution system (PDS) and eliminate bogus beneficiaries. Through eKYC, Aadhaar verification ensures that only genuine and deserving families continue to receive subsidized food grains.

Key Objectives Behind eKYC Implementation

  • Ensure transparency in ration distribution
  • Eliminate fake and duplicate ration cards
  • Link ration cards to Aadhaar for identification
  • Prevent leakage and corruption in the PDS
  • Improve targeting for poor and deserving households

States like Uttar Pradesh, Bihar, Madhya Pradesh, and Rajasthan have already begun mass awareness campaigns urging people to complete their eKYC by the stipulated deadline.

What Happens if You Don’t Complete eKYC?

The consequences of not updating your ration card with eKYC can be severe. The Department of Food and Public Distribution has clarified that failure to complete the eKYC process may lead to suspension or cancellation of ration card benefits.

Possible Implications Include:

  • Immediate discontinuation of free monthly ration
  • Removal of names from the beneficiary list
  • Denial of additional benefits under schemes like PMGKAY
  • Ineligibility for digital ration card conversion in the future

According to government sources, over 1.8 crore ration cards were already deleted during previous verification drives due to non-compliance or duplication.

Step-by-Step Guide to Complete Your Ration Card eKYC

Completing the eKYC is a simple process and can be done both online and offline. Here’s a guide to help you through it:

Offline Method:

  1. Visit your nearest ration shop or Common Service Center (CSC)
  2. Carry your Aadhaar card and ration card
  3. Biometric verification (fingerprint scan) will be done on the spot
  4. Confirm your mobile number for OTP-based verification
  5. Receive confirmation once eKYC is successfully updated

Online Method (if available in your state):

  1. Visit your state food department’s official portal
  2. Enter your ration card number and Aadhaar details
  3. Submit OTP received on your Aadhaar-linked mobile
  4. Download confirmation receipt or acknowledgment

State-wise eKYC Deadlines and Support Centers

Below is a table of eKYC deadlines and helpline information for major states:

State eKYC Deadline Portal Link / Support Number Free Helpline Language Support
Uttar Pradesh 30 May 2025 fcs.up.gov.in 1967 Hindi, Urdu
Bihar 25 May 2025 epds.bihar.gov.in 1800-3456-194 Hindi
Madhya Pradesh 31 May 2025 nfsa.samagra.gov.in 181 Hindi
Rajasthan 28 May 2025 food.raj.nic.in 1800-180-6127 Hindi, Rajasthani
Maharashtra 15 June 2025 mahafood.gov.in 1800-22-4950 Marathi, Hindi
West Bengal 10 June 2025 wbpds.wb.gov.in 1967 Bengali, Hindi
Tamil Nadu 5 June 2025 tnpds.gov.in 1967 Tamil, English
Telangana 31 May 2025 epds.telangana.gov.in 1967 Telugu, Hindi
